New face arrives at Premier Partnership

May 24, 2022

Premier Partnership have had a new face join the team this month with the arrival of Robin Harris who takes up the role of Client Relationship Director.

Robin has eighteen years’ experience building and maintaining relationships with a range of clients across many sectors and joins Premier Partnership after a managing a global portfolio of clients for a market leading talent acquisition company. 

His arrival will ensure Premier Partnership continues to provide their clients with outstanding transformational learning. Robin will be looking after our blue light clients providing them with strategic, operational, bespoke, and off-the-shelf learning solutions.

Managing Director, David Pearson said, “We are very fortunate to have found Robin, his ability to understand the needs of clients and quickly identify solutions to assist them will be a real asset to Premier Partnership”

Robin is relishing his role within the Premier Partnership family saying “I am delighted to be joining such a fantastic and recognised company, and I am extremely excited about building relationships with our clients and helping them find solutions to their learning and development requirements”
